Characteristics of the Earth-ionosphere Waveguide for VLF Radio Waves by James R. Wait,K. P. Spies Pdf

The principal results of this technical note are graphical presentations of the attenuation rates, phase velocities, and excitation factors for the dominant modes in the earth-ionosphere waveguide.The frequency range considered is 8 kc/s to 30 kc/s. *The model adopted for the ionosphere has an exponential variation for both the electron density and the collision frequency, and the effect of the earth's magnetic field is considered.Comparison with published experimental data confirms that the minimum attenuation of VLF radio waves in daytime is approximtely at 18 kc/s, while at night it is somewhat lower.The directional dependences of propagation predicted by the theory are also confirmed by experimental data.(Author).

VLF Mode Calculations for Propagation Across a Land/sea Boundary in the Earth-ionosphere Waveguide by James R. Wait,K. P. Spies Pdf

Using a rather idealized ionospheric model, the conversion of VLF waveguide modes is considered for a discontinuity in the earth's surface properties. The method is based principally on modal analysis, although the connection with an earlier integral equation formulation is demonstrated. Extensive numerical results for the modal parameters and the conversion coefficients are given. Taken together, it is believed that the results may be employed for the quantitative interpretation of observed data and for the prediction of expected fields over rather complicated mixed land/sea paths at VLF.

Terrestrial Propagation of Long Electromagnetic Waves by Janis Galejs Pdf

Terrestrial Propagation of Long Electromagnetic Waves deals with the propagation of long electromagnetic waves confined principally to the shell between the earth and the ionosphere, known as the terrestrial waveguide. The discussion is limited to steady-state solutions in a waveguide that is uniform in the direction of propagation. Wave propagation is characterized almost exclusively by mode theory. The mathematics are developed only for sources at the ground surface or within the waveguide, including artificial sources as well as lightning discharges. This volume is comprised of nine chapters and begins with an introduction to the fundamental concepts of wave propagation in a planar and curved isotropic waveguide. A number of examples are presented to illustrate the effects of an anisotropic ionosphere. The basic equations are summarized and plane-wave reflection from a dielectric interface is considered, along with the superposition of two obliquely incident plane waves. The properties of waveguide boundaries are implicitly represented by Fresnel reflection coefficients. Subsequent chapters focus on boundaries of the terrestrial guide; lightning discharges as a natural source of extremely-low-frequency and very-low-frequency radiation; and the mode theory for waves in an isotropic spherical shell. VLF/LF Reflection Properties of the Low Latitude Ionosphere by Wayne I. Klemetti Pdf

Low latitude observations of VLF/LF pulse reflections from the lower ionosphere obtained at nine locations to the east and west of a transmitter in southeastern Brazil are described. The data provide a variety of information on the reflection properties of the ionosphere below about 90 km altitude. Aspects of the data are presented in quasi-dimensional formats useful for identifying ionosphere structure and variability, and detailed analyses of portions of the data provided, which characterize the effective heights of the reflection coefficients of the ionosphere at noon and midnight, over a frequency range from 15 to 65 kHz. Electron density models of the ionosphere, derived from VLF/LF reflection data are also discussed. Keywords: VLF propagation; LF Propagation; Ionosphere reflectivity d region.

Low Frequency Wave-reflection Properties of the Equatorial Ionosphere by John E. Rasmussen Pdf

A joint United States - Brazil experiment was conducted near the geomagnetic equator to confirm the theoretically predicted strong dependence of the ionospheric reflection properties on the azimuthal direction of wave propagation. Skywave delays, reflection coefficients, and polarization ellipses were measured at different frequencies, ranges, and azimuths. The results were compared with full-wave computer calculations for several ionospheric models. A series of high resolution waveforms showing the sunrise transition from night- to daytime conditions is included.

Transfer Characteristics of Radio Waves Propagated Between the Ionosphere and the Earth at Very Low Frequencies by J. R. Johler Pdf

The transfer characteristics (amplitude and phase as a function of frequency) of the sky wave propagated between the D-region and the E-region of the ionosphere and the earth have been evaluated at low and very low frequencies by the geometrical-optical theory employing the quasi-longitudinal approximation of the ionosphere reflection coefficients. Distances, d/j, up to 1000 statute miles are considered and multiple hops or time-modes (j = 1, 2, 3, ... ) are evaluated for a vertical electric dipole source. The effects of the electron density, collision frequency, intensity of the earth's magnetic field and the geometrical parameters are illustrated. The effect of the vertical lapse of the permittivity of the earth's atmosphere is introduced into the computation.
